can anyone help? i have a stock axial wraith that i have replaced a stripped out steering servo with a high torque savox servo. i have been beating my head against a wall trying to find a link on this forum using the search, online guides, savox and axial sites and am not having any luck finding info on how to set the servo end points if anyone can guide me in the right direction that would be great.....thanx...jim

Done via your radio. Knowing which radio you have will allow us to help answer your questions.

You wont have total control over your end points with a stock radio. You'll have to get a Spektrum, FlySky or Futaba to get full advantage of your end points.
